| Cross-site scripting (XSS) vulnerability in webmail.php in SquirrelMail before 1.4.4 allows remote attackers to inject arbitrary web script or HTML via certain integer variables. |
| Unknown vulnerability in typespeed 0.4.1 and earlier allows local users to gain privileges. |
| SSLeay.pm in libnet-ssleay-perl before 1.25 uses the /tmp/entropy file for entropy if a source is not set in the EGD_PATH variable, which allows local users to reduce the cryptographic strength of certain operations by modifying the file. |
| bsmtpd 2.3 and earlier does not properly sanitize e-mail addresses, which allows remote attackers to execute arbitrary commands. |
| Apache mod_auth_radius 1.5.4 and libpam-radius-auth allow remote malicious RADIUS servers to cause a denial of service (crash) via a RADIUS_REPLY_MESSAGE with a RADIUS attribute length of 1, which leads to a memcpy operation with a -1 length argument. |
| Hyper-Threading technology, as used in FreeBSD and other operating systems that are run on Intel Pentium and other processors, allows local users to use a malicious thread to create covert channels, monitor the execution of other threads, and obtain sensitive information such as cryptographic keys, via a timing attack on memory cache misses. |
| Internet Explorer 6 on Windows XP SP2 allows remote attackers to bypass the file download warning dialog and possibly trick an unknowledgeable user into executing arbitrary code via a web page with a body element containing an onclick tag, as demonstrated using the createElement function. |
| Stack-based buffer overflow in the websql CGI program in MySQL MaxDB 7.5.00 allows remote attackers to execute arbitrary code via a long password parameter. |
| The web-based administrative interface for 3Com OfficeConnect Wireless 11g Access Point (AP) 1.00.08, and possibly earlier versions before 1.03.07A, allows remote attackers to bypass authentication and obtain sensitive information by directly accessing the (1) config.bin (2) profile.wlp?PN=ggg or (3) event.logs URLs. |
| inpview in SGI IRIX allows local users to execute arbitrary commands via the SUN_TTSESSION_CMD environment variable, which is executed by inpview without dropping privileges. |
| vsdatant.sys in Zone Lab ZoneAlarm before 5.5.062.011, ZoneAlarm Wireless before 5.5.080.000, Check Point Integrity Client 4.x before 4.5.122.000 and 5.x before 5.1.556.166 do not properly verify that the ServerPortName argument to the NtConnectPort function is a valid memory address, which allows local users to cause a denial of service (system crash) when ZoneAlarm attempts to dereference an invalid pointer. |
| Stack-based buffer overflow in DataRescue Interactive Disassembler (IDA) Pro 4.7 allows attackers to execute arbitrary code via a PE file with an Import Address Table containing a long import library name. |
| AWStats 6.1, and other versions before 6.3, allows remote attackers to execute arbitrary commands via shell metacharacters in the configdir parameter to aswtats.pl. |
| Buffer overflow in XShisen before 1.36 allows local users to execute arbitrary code via a long GECOS field. |
| helvis 1.8h2_1 and earlier stores recovery files in world readable directories with world readable permissions, which allows local users to read the recovered files of other users. |
| helvis 1.8h2_1 and earlier allows local users to recover and read the files of other users via the elvrec setuid program. |
| helvis 1.8h2_1 and earlier allows local users to delete arbitrary files via the elvprsv setuid program. |
| Multiple buffer overflows in golddig 2.0 and earlier allow local users to execute arbitrary code via (1) a long map name command line argument or (2) a long username as recorded in the USER environment variable. |
| The coda_pioctl function in the coda functionality (pioctl.c) for Linux kernel 2.6.9 and 2.4.x before 2.4.29 may allow local users to cause a denial of service (crash) or execute arbitrary code via negative vi.in_size or vi.out_size values, which may trigger a buffer overflow. |
| The "at" commands on Mac OS X 10.3.7 and earlier do not properly drop privileges, which allows local users to (1) delete arbitrary files via atrm, (2) execute arbitrary programs via the -f argument to batch, or (3) read arbitrary files via the -f argument to batch, which generates a job file that is readable by the local user. |
